//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
/*
 * memfd test file-system
 * This file uses FUSE to create a dummy file-system with only one file /memfd.
 * This file is read-only and takes 1s per read.
 *
 * This file-system is used by the memfd test-cases to force the kernel to pin
 * pages during reads(). Due to the 1s delay of this file-system, this is a
 * nice way to test race-conditions against get_user_pages() in the kernel.
 *
 * We use direct_io==1 to force the kernel to use direct-IO for this
 * file-system.
 */

#define FUSE_USE_VERSION 26

#include <fuse.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<unistd.h>

static const char memfd_content[] = "memfd-example-content";
static const char memfd_path[] = "/memfd";

static int memfd_getattr(const char *path, struct stat *st)
{
        memset(st, 0, sizeof(*st));

        if (!strcmp(path, "/")) {
                st->st_mode = S_IFDIR | 0755;
                st->st_nlink = 2;
        } else if (!strcmp(path, memfd_path)) {
                st->st_mode = S_IFREG | 0444;
                st->st_nlink = 1;
                st->st_size = strlen(memfd_content);
        } else {
                return -ENOENT;
        }

        return 0;
}

static int memfd_readdir(const char *path,
                         void *buf,
                         fuse_fill_dir_t filler,
                         off_t offset,
                         struct fuse_file_info *fi)
{
        if (strcmp(path, "/"))
                return -ENOENT;

        filler(buf, ".", NULL, 0);
        filler(buf, "..", NULL, 0);
        filler(buf, memfd_path + 1, NULL, 0);

        return 0;
}

static int memfd_open(const char *path, struct fuse_file_info *fi)
{
        if (strcmp(path, memfd_path))
                return -ENOENT;

        if ((fi->flags & 3) != O_RDONLY)
                return -EACCES;

        /* force direct-IO */
        fi->direct_io = 1;

        return 0;
}

static int memfd_read(const char *path,
                      char *buf,
                      size_t size,
                      off_t offset,
                      struct fuse_file_info *fi)
{
        size_t len;

        if (strcmp(path, memfd_path) != 0)
                return -ENOENT;

        sleep(1);

        len = strlen(memfd_content);
        if (offset < len) {
                if (offset + size > len)
                        size = len - offset;

                memcpy(buf, memfd_content + offset, size);
        } else {
                size = 0;
        }

        return size;
}

static struct fuse_operations memfd_ops = {
        .getattr        = memfd_getattr,
        .readdir        = memfd_readdir,
        .open           = memfd_open,
        .read           = memfd_read,
};

int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
        return fuse_main(argc, argv, &memfd_ops, NULL);
}
